    Do yourself a favor and skip this tour. Go in buy some cool merch and maybe ask if you can watch…read morethe video they play at the beginning of the "tour" which was about 75% of it. Or just search for YouTube videos on the history of ice. I wouldn't even have minded if they charged you a couple of bucks for this 15 minute tour in which the guide literally shows you some pictures of frequent customers and blocks of ice and then dumps you off at the dock behind the building. Not sure what I expected but couldn't believe that this actually got good reviews at all. Again great merch, got some cool hats and the t-shirts were pretty sweet but the tour...thumbs down!

    This is one of the "coolest" and most unique tours I have gone on while hanging out on the North…read moreShore. Our tour guide Sam showed us a movie that told the history of the ice industry, Then we took a little stroll around the modern facility that services the fishing industry and makes bagged ice for the local area. We even saw some seals frolicking near the dock where the ice is loaded onto fishing boats! I imagine this tour would be fantastic any time of year. The length and price were more than appropriate. Besides, they sell neat t-shirts, hoodies, etc. right there in the gift shop. My only regret was that I didn't have any cash on hand to tip our fantastic tour guide. Sam, we owe you are beer! After their tour, you will saying, "Next time, make it Cape Pond Ice!"
